SplitWeave assigns A/B experiment buckets at request time, so every deployed build must be traceable to its exact commit and config bundle. Future maintainers: never promote an artifact whose provenance manifest is missing or hand-edited, because bucket hashing constants are baked in at compile time and silently diverge otherwise. The Harbell release pipeline signs each artifact and records the manifest digest alongside the rollout record. The token for the currently deployed build is recorded below.

pipeline stamp: htk9_ce63042d9

Context for the security reviewer: the report builder's stable-sort guarantee depends on a signed tiebreaker index, and regenerating that index requires the maintenance account. If that account is locked after a failed rotation, recover it before re-running the stability validation suite, otherwise sorted exports may interleave rows nondeterministically. Verify the audit log shows no unexpected recovery attempts first. Then unlock the maintenance account using the recovery passphrase below.

unlock words, kajef-kadug: sorys-pelax-lamael-tamvan-briiel-novdor-fenwyn-tamdor-oliion-keleth-julok-belion-ralok

Subject: Cron-to-Windmere cut-over summary

Hello plugin authors — as of this morning, all scheduled jobs on the Larkspur platform have been migrated from host-level cron to the Windmere workflow engine. Legacy crontabs have been disabled but preserved for thirty days. Plugins registering scheduled tasks must now declare them via the Windmere manifest; direct cron registration will be rejected. The engine settings your plugins will run under are the following.

settings of kahag-bagug:
[quenath]
port = 6379
region = outer-2
host = quenath.nelvrocorp.internal
timeout_ms = 2000
retries = 3